The Pueblo Riverwalk is a 32-acre urban waterfront experience in downtown Pueblo, Colorado, offering a scenic blend of history, art, and recreation. Following a devastating flood in 1921, the Arkansas River was rerouted. The Riverwalk returned the river to its original location, revitalizing the downtown area.

Discover more about Pueblo Riverwalk

The Historic Arkansas Riverwalk of Pueblo (HARP) is a vibrant centerpiece of the city, offering a unique blend of history, culture, and recreation. Spanning 32 acres, this urban waterfront has transformed a once-neglected area into a thriving destination for locals and tourists alike. The Riverwalk's story began with the Great Pueblo Flood of 1921, which devastated the city's downtown. In response, the Arkansas River was rerouted. Almost 60 years later, Pueblo was facing economic challenges, and civic leaders decided to revitalize downtown Pueblo and bring back the river. Inspired by the San Antonio Riverwalk, the community voted to fund the project, which opened in 2000. Today, the Riverwalk is home to a mile-long channel, lined with restaurants, shops, and public art. Visitors can enjoy a narrated history tour by boat, stroll along the paved walkways, and admire the 54 outdoor sculptures that dot the landscape. The Veterans' Bridge, dedicated in 2010, honors the men and women who have served in the military. The Riverwalk also hosts a variety of events throughout the year, including concerts, movies, and festivals. The HARP Authority continues to expand the Riverwalk, with a new boathouse and river channel extension slated for completion in 2025. This ongoing development ensures that the Pueblo Riverwalk remains a dynamic and engaging destination for years to come.

    Getting There

    Walking

    The Pueblo Riverwalk is located in downtown Pueblo, easily accessible on foot from most central locations. From the Pueblo Transit Center, head east on W 4th Street for about 0.3 miles, then turn left onto E Riverwalk. The Riverwalk is at 125 E Riverwalk.

    Public Transport

    Pueblo Transit offers bus service to the downtown area. Take Route 1 to the Pueblo Transit Center, then walk east on W 4th Street and turn left onto E Riverwalk. Check the Pueblo Transit schedule for current routes and fares. A single ride fare is typically around $1.25.

    Ride-Sharing

    Ride-sharing services like Uber and Lyft are available in Pueblo. Request a ride to 125 E Riverwalk, Pueblo, CO 81003. Fares vary depending on the distance and time of day; expect to pay around $8-$15 for a short trip within the city.

    Driving

    If driving, take I-25 South and exit onto US-50 East. Continue for about 2 miles, then take the exit for Pueblo Boulevard and turn left. After 1 mile, turn right onto E Riverwalk. The Riverwalk is on your left at 125 E Riverwalk. Parking is available in the surrounding downtown area. Monthly parking permits are available. Check AirGarage for parking options. Metered street parking is also available, with rates typically around $1 per hour.
